Hungarian chicken soup (csirkeleves) or (tyukleves)

4 Servings

Ingredients

QuantityIngredient
1Fat hen or chicken parts disjointed (about 5 lbs.)
5Carrots, whole
1Whole parsley root with greens on top
2Onions each stuck with a whole clove
3Ribs of celery
1smallWhole tomato
4quartsWater
tablespoonSalt
¼teaspoonFresh ground black pepper
teaspoonMace
1Raw chicken liver chopped fine
4Sprigs of parsley greens, minced
1smallOnion, minced
4Whole eggs
½tablespoonSalt
2cupsFlour

Cook chicken in pot with water, skiming the scum off when starting soup to boil. Place all the vegetables and spices in the pot. Cook under a low flame until the chicken is tender. Remove as much fat as possible. Strain soup and serve with broad noodles or LIVER DUMPLINGS. Eat chicken on the side with TOMATO SAUCE or DILL SAUCE.

LIVER DUMPLINGS Mix all the ingredients together. A cusinart is great for this. Drop into boiling water by the ½ teaspoonsful. Cook about 15 minutes or until done. If batter is too thick you can add a little water.

Drain and serve with soup. Serves a family.
